I've had a number of troubles trying to use them together with spm.
I've got it running finally, so here is how I got around my problems, in
case someone else is interested (i think I saw a post earlier asking
about the combination)..
1. Matlab 6 requires an upgrade of glibc to glibc2.2. I've been trying
to do it with the RPM, and it's just not happening for me. There are a
number of conflicts that make the rpm fail. "Luckily", one can still
run matlab without java by starting it with 'matlab -nojvm'. ANyone
know how to properly do the upgrade to glibc2.2?
2. When you start spm, there seems to be a problem with spm_platform.m
. It turns out that in some calls to probe what the platform is, the
system returns 'GLNX86', instead of the expected 'LNX86' string. This
was solved by adding another couple of lines making 'LNX86' and 'GLNX86'
do the same things.
3. Finally, the spm box comes up, but there is a crash due to needing to
compile the mex files with spm_MAKE.sh. I found this odd, since I
didn't have to do this when running Matlab 5.3 on red hat 6.2. Fine, so
I ran the spm_MAKE.sh, and it crashed mysteriously. It turned out that
I needed to specify the path of gccopts.sh in the script (just like it
said on the warning). ie- replace gccopts.sh with
/opt/matlab6.0/bin/gccopts.sh .... or whatever your path is ...
now everything seems to be working for now...
